PM bans tourism activities on pristine Binh Ba island due to security



KHANH HOA (VNS) — According to a directive by Prime Minister Nguyen Tan Dung that takes effect on November 6, the Government will ban all tourism activities on Binh Ba Island in the central province of Khanh Hoa, citing security reasons.


The island, along with Chut Isle and Hoi Cape, also in Cam Ranh Bay are located within the Cam Ranh Military Base.


People and vehicles traveling from and to this area must be strictly controlled to ensure security and safety, the directive said.


Binh Ba is the largest island in the deep-water Cam Ranh Bay. It has recently emerged as an attractive destination thanks to its pristine beauty. — VNS
